Gertrude Projection Festival 2012 Animation Piece

This was a collaboration between myself and the talented Chris Staring of skaremedia - skaremedia.com

It was our joint submission for the Gertrude Projection Festival 2012, which was projected in a shopfront on Getrude st, Fitzroy, here in Melbourne this past July.

Selandra Community Place Project and Launch

I worked on a series of motion graphics animations (12 minutes in total), at ASPECT Studios Digital, for the sustainable display home “Selandra Community Place”.
Our project team, along with Studio Binocular, developed a branding and interactive media strategy to promote and educate sustainability practices in the home.

Pausefest

Pause Fest is a unique digital arts/culture/design festival, based in Melbourne. The first physical fest was in November last year, spread over lots of venues throughout the CBD.
I thoroughly enjoyed attending many of the events and helping to document the festival (helping shoot some interviews & bits & pieces with Melbourne DSLR).

Philip Bloom & Ric Creaser FilmMaker Workshop 2012; Melbourne

On March the 1st, Philip Bloom (Director, Cinematographer – UK) kicked off his workshop tour of Australia/New Zealand, here in Melbourne.

I’d booked tickets back in November and was looking forward to this one massively.
It didn’t disappoint. I met up with some of the Melbourne DSLR club guys down there and helped shoot a few clips – we produced the video above as a little promo for the rest of the tour.

As well as learning lots of little cool tips and bits of info, we got to check out some of Philip’s plethora of cameras, including the Sony FS-100 and new Canon C300 (DROOL).
He also projected some of his amazing work on the FS100, broadcast the C300 live over hdmi (Amazing high ISO performance), and played some of his brilliant work (timelapses were my fav).
